
ALL POLITICAL ACTIVITIES STILL ON HALT, RESPECT ORDERS, APC CAUTIONS PDP
Press release
27/04/2020.
The attention of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Plateau State chapter, has been drawn to a planned violation of the Plateau State Government Executive Order on the fight against the novel Coronavirus, by a faction of the State chapter of the People’s Democratic Party (PDP), to hold large political gathering in some few days to come.
We have it on good authority that the PDP, intends to bring together a lot of people to inaugurate a faction of its purported new wards executive committees, probably on Thursday, the 30 of April 2020. Such an action if and when it happens is a clear manifestation of the PDP’s recklessness and clear violation of the Executive Order, instituting total lockdown and banning all gatherings, including political activities.
It is instructive to stress that, such actio is not only an affront on the executive order, but a clear non chalannt attitude of the PDP, that is tantamount to disrespect to constituted authority and inimical towards the overall well being of our people.
Whereas, going by the unseen common enemy in place, the novel Coronavirus, and pursuant to the executive order, today all political parties seems to be silent as the world bows to “COVID-19 political party,” which we should in unison come together to fight to the latter. Unfortunately, the PDP is toying with this monster and playing bad games with the lives of the Plateau people.
If it were for just political reasons, we wouldn’t have cared to talk, but because we feel that our people need protection and must be protected, we therefore cannot fold our arms seeing unmindful people trying to abuse the well being of our people and by extension the might of governance.
The PDP or any other person or persons are hereby reminded and cautioned that the APC lead adminstration will not condone any act that will breach the safety and well being of its people.
At this juncture, we are urging the PDP to halt any planned political activity in the interest of the well being of the people, until the state is declared free of the common enimy of the novel Coronavirus.
In the event where they fail to heed this call, we further urge the relevant security agencies and apprehend all violators of Government directives.
